Title 9 BUILDINGS AND CONSTRUCTION
Chapter 9.07 HOURS FOR OUTSIDE CONSTRUCTION WORK AND MECHANICAL BLOWERS
9.07.020 Outside construction or repair work—When prohibited, emergency work exception.
It shall be unlawful for any person to operate equipment or perform any
outside construction or repair work on any building, structure, project, or use
any pneumatic hammer, steam or electric hoist, backhoe, bulldozer, or dump truck
or other construction type device before the hour of 8:00 a.m. or after 8:00
p.m., on any Monday through Friday; or before the hours of 9:00 a.m. or after
the hour of 5:00 p.m., on any Saturday; or at any time on any Sunday or public
holiday. For the purposes of this Chapter, “public holiday” shall
mean each day designated by resolution of the Monte Sereno City Council as an
official holiday. If the City Manager finds evidence that an emergency exists
that imperils the public safety, the City Manager may direct the construction or
maintenance work to proceed during such hours as may be necessary for the
duration of the emergency. (Ord. 147 § 1 (part), 2005)
